Summary
British American Tobacco Australia Limited, Imperial Tobacco Australia Limited and Philip Morris Limited (the Applicants) seek authorisation for an arrangement between them whereby they intend to work together to identify, issue warning notices and, if warning notices are not heeded, suspend or cease supply of their tobacco products to retailers and wholesalers who sell illicit tobacco products.
On 23 June 2017 the ACCC issued a determination denying authorisation to the arrangements.
